As the number 5 is a lucky number for me, I noticed the date was the 5th of the 5th so I created a cache without really knowing what to call it. I then discovered that it was a special day in its own right and was known throughout the world as Cinco de Mayo.

Cinco de Mayo—or the Fifth of May—is a holiday that celebrates the date of the Mexican army’s 1862 victory over France at the Battle of Puebla during the Franco-Mexican War (1861-1867).
